草庐IT

imageView1

全部标签

android ImageView setPadding 没有效果

我正在尝试设置ImageView的填充。我的代码在下面privatevoidcreateEpisodeView(){floatscale=this.getResources().getDisplayMetrics().density;intpadding=(int)(PADDING*scale+0.5f);rlItemsRoot=(LinearLayout)findViewById(R.id.rl_items_root);for(inti=0;i但是没有效果。但是当我在XML中设置它时,它看起来很好。 最佳答案 A你注意到自己正在使

android - 如何更改 ImageView 中设置的形状的颜色

现在问题从设置形状的颜色开始。我在drawable中创建了一个矩形形状并将其设置为ImageView像这样编辑我的case_priority.xml现在我需要改变这个形状的颜色。实际上这个颜色来自网络服务,我需要改变它。所以我的问题是:我们如何以编程方式更改此形状的颜色。并将其设置为ImageView。我已经在stackoverflow中浏览了几个示例,但我无法将其更改为ImageView。请帮助!!!!提前致谢。编辑:可能是我的问题没说清楚,所以只是提炼一下问题。实际上,我有一个ImageView,我在其中设置了一个实际上是可绘制对象的源。默认情况下,它的绿色如我上面显示的代码所示。

android - 在 imageview android 中间插入一个 textview

我需要在ImageView中间放置一个TextView,所以我有这段代码我需要最后一个textview始终位于menu_iconImageView的中心,但我的方法不起作用,它只是将它放在左上角。 最佳答案 由于您的ImageView没有填充所有RelativeLayout,您无法达到理想的效果。我建议您将ImageView和TextView放在FrameLayout中。 关于android-在imageviewandroid中间插入一个textview,我们在StackOverflow

android - 在 imageview 中拉伸(stretch)图像以适应 xml 中的屏幕

我在drawable中有图像,需要用作背景。它需要拉伸(stretch)以填满屏幕..我知道如何使用Java代码将图像全屏拉伸(stretch)。但是在XML中如何做到这一点。 最佳答案 android:scaleType="fitXY"将拉伸(stretch)图像以适应ImageView的完整尺寸 关于android-在imageview中拉伸(stretch)图像以适应xml中的屏幕,我们在StackOverflow上找到一个类似的问题: https://

android - 在 android 中捏缩放以获得 ImageView ?

我有一个要求,我必须在捏合时放大和缩小图像。如果有人可以建议我为Imageview提供捏合缩放功能。???? 最佳答案 只需执行以下操作即可实现缩放,将您的图像放在Assets文件夹中并提供此代码,StringimageUrl="file:///android_asset/abc.png";WebViewwv=(WebView)findViewById(R.id.yourwebview);wv.getSettings().setBuiltInZoomControls(true);wv.loadUrl(imageUrl);

android - 如何让imageview不停的旋转?

关闭。这个问题需要debuggingdetails.它目前不接受答案。编辑问题以包含desiredbehavior,aspecificproblemorerror,andtheshortestcodenecessarytoreproducetheproblem.这将有助于其他人回答问题。关闭7年前。Improvethisquestion我在Activity中间有一个imageview,我该如何让它无限旋转360度?

android imageview 长按和长按

我有一个imageview,我需要长按(上下文菜单)和常规按键才能正常工作。我可以让一个或另一个工作,但不能同时工作。我错过了什么?下面的代码仅适用于普通打印机。只要我触摸屏幕,它就会开始执行onTouch代码。ImageViewimage=(ImageView)findViewById(R.id.visible_image);image.setLongClickable(true);image.setOnTouchListener(newOnTouchListener(){publicbooleanonTouch(Viewv,MotionEventev){switch(ev.getA

android - 如何将Imageview置于其他布局之后

我正在为动画使用imageview,这样它看起来就像从左到右的移动。但是我的图像显示在其他View的前面,以便用户能够单击图像。我正在尝试将其显示在另一个View的后面。 最佳答案 将ImageView放在上方(在顶部-父级的第一个子级)xml文件中的布局,这样图像将位于布局后面 关于android-如何将Imageview置于其他布局之后,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questi

android - 如何在从url加载的ImageView中淡入图片

我想对ImageView应用淡入动画,以创建从url加载的图像在下载完成时淡入的效果。我知道如何将图像从url下载到ImageView,如thisanswer,我知道如何将淡入动画应用到imageViewlikehere.这次尝试Drawabled=ImageUtils.fetchDrawable("theurl");imageView.setImageDrawable(d);imageView.startAnimation(fadeInAnimation);产生闪烁效果(看、看不到、淡入看)。颠倒最后两行的顺序也会导致闪烁。我用谷歌搜索并搜索了回调/监听器形式的解决方案-如下所示:i

带有多点触控的 Android Gallery 适配器?自定义图库还是自定义 ImageView?

我想重新创建与Gallery3D相同类型的应用程序,但更简单:没有3D动画,基本上只保留GridView和Gallery小部件。我还想在所选图像上启用多点触控缩放-拖动-滚动,这就是我苦苦挣扎的地方。我在网上查找了简单的教程,还查看了Gallery3D源代码,但找不到合适的解决方案。我能得到的最接近的是在我的图库适配器中使用下面的自定义ImageView。它有效,我可以捏合缩放和拖动,只是图像离开屏幕并且我无法滚动到图库中的下一张图像。捏合缩放也不是完美的,因为它只能缩放图像而不能正确地使图像重新居中。我应该改为在Gallery上添加onTouchEvent吗?importandroi